Tattoo Description: A traditional style sugar skull takes center stage, adorned with vibrant lotus flowers and roses. The design utilizes bold outlines, vibrant red and turquoise color palettes, and classic shading techniques to create depth and dimension.
**1. Artistic Style and Technique:**
The tattoo is executed in a Neo-traditional style, drawing inspiration from classic American Traditional tattooing but with updated linework and color palettes. The use of bold outlines and solid color fills with subtle shading for dimension are key elements of this style. The technique demonstrates a strong understanding of color theory and line weight.
**2. Design Elements and Composition:**
The composition is vertically oriented, with the sugar skull as the focal point. The lotus flowers above and roses below frame the skull, creating a balanced and visually appealing arrangement. The use of swirling, stylized background elements adds movement and emphasizes the central image. The symmetry of the skull design further enhances the overall balance.
**3. Recommended Body Placement:**
Given the vertical orientation and moderate size, this design would be well-suited for placement on the upper arm, thigh, calf, or sternum. The shape could also work well on the back, fitting nicely between the shoulder blades.
**4. Visual Details and Execution Quality:**
The linework is clean and consistent, indicating skillful execution. The color saturation is vibrant and evenly applied. The shading is subtle but effective, adding depth and preventing the design from appearing flat. The details within the sugar skull’s decoration, such as the floral eye sockets and patterned brow, are well-defined and contribute to the overall visual interest. The overall execution quality demonstrates a high level of technical skill.
